Frequently Asked Questions about Secaucus
What type of rentals are currently available in Secaucus?
There are currently 3631 Apartments for Rent in Secaucus, NJ with pricing that ranges from $800 to $16,461. There are also 272 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Secaucus ranging from $850 to $10,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Secaucus?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Secaucus ranges from $850 to $10,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,187.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Secaucus?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Secaucus range from $1,500 to $16,461,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,290 to $6,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,450 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,300.
